= Document Transport: HSM Delivery =

This page covers the inbound delivery of the Verax-9 hardware security module to the Tallow Ridge warehouse. The unit ships in a sealed crate with dual tamper seals and must remain in the caged area until the security officer signs the intake log. Do not open the crate for inspection; seal verification only. The shift lead accepts the crate personally from the Pellgrave courier, following this instruction.

courier memo of bajef-kawip: the kelax praeth courier leaves the prawyn belox gorix belvan raldor oliwyn fraion novok ledger at gate 3944 under passcode 269309

Subject: Payroll export format change — heads up

Team,

Starting next cycle, Wagecrest exports switch from fixed-width to delimited records. Downstream parsers in Ledgerfox must be updated before Friday's cut. Old-format files will be rejected by the intake job, no fallback. Migration script is merged; run it once per tenant. Raise blockers at the weekly sync, not after. The canary build that produced the new format is already tagged, and its token is below.

trace token, fafog-kageg: htk4_98e6

Priority: high. The planner regression on Mistvale cluster B (joins spilling to disk since the 4.2 rollout) can't be investigated because the diag account creds expired Sunday. EXPLAIN captures and plan-cache dumps both fail auth. Regression itself is reproducible: three-table joins on the orders schema choose nested loops over hash joins, ~40x slower. On-call: rotate the diag account first, then pull plans from the last 48h for comparison. Fresh key for the Mistvale diagnostics service is below.

gateway credential: kto23_dolYgAScEh2TaPOlStqOl98

Recovery — Scrubjay EXIF-scrubbing service. Lockouts usually follow key rotation. Verify requester via the Moorcroft ticket queue, then reissue the worker token from the ops console. Scrub jobs resume automatically; no reprocessing needed. Reviewers: check that recovered accounts keep the least-privilege role. Console break-glass access requires the passphrase stated immediately below.

vault phrase of tajop-haduf = holath-brivan-wenax